I use blogging to get out the word about what I am up to and what my plans to draw a little attention to my ventures. I am learning to keep a friendly but interesting tone to try to build readership and try to include enough good tags in the body of each post.

I am concerned about keyword density being TOO great. What is a good formula or dispersal for key words that still maintains tag rich content? How many times in a 500 to 900 word entry would it be safe to repeat tags/keywords?

A lot of the top ranked sites only have a .3% density which is far to low. I would say 1.5% would be a good denisty. It is enough to be highly ranked for it but it wouldn't be considered keyword stuffing by google.
